The Cornerstones of Trustworthy Licensing and Security

When Canadian players begin their search for a reliable online casino, the very first element they must scrutinise is the licensing and security framework. In Canada, there is no federal gambling regulator; instead, provinces and territories deal their own regimes, and many reputable online casinos serving Canadian players hold licences from the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ario (AGCO) for the province of Ontario, or from the Kahnawake Gaming Commission (KGC) for operations based in the Mohawk Territory of Kahnawake. These bodies apply rigorous standards for player trade protection, game selection fairness, and financial transparency. A licence from the AGCO or the KGC signals that the casino has undergone thorough background checks and must adhere to strict codes of conduct. For instance, AGCO licensees are required to participate in the province’s iGaming securities industry, which mandates responsible gambling tools like PlaySmart, while KGC licensees must comply with its Technical Standards for gaming systems, which ensure random outcomes and data integrity. Beyond the licence itself, protection measures are paramount. Every trustworthy casino should employ 128-bit or 256-bit SSL encryption to protect all data transfers between the player and the site. This encryption ensures that personal details such as names, addresses, and banking information remain inaccessible to unauthorised parties. Additionally, look for casinos that have got their games and random number generators (RNGs) audited by independent third-party testing agencies like e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I (Gaming Laboratories International). An scrutinize certification or seal off on the website indicates that the games are truly random and that the stated return-to-player percentages are accurate. Many players overlook these details, but they are the bedrock of a safe gambling environment. A casino that cannot clearly display its licence number, encryption details, and audit certifications should be viewed with great suspicion. Furthermore, responsible gambling tools such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ks are also hallmarks of a licensed and honourable operator. For example, Ontario-licensed casinos must offer a mandatory deposit limit upon signup, while KGC-regulated sites are required to furnish links to problem gambling helplines and authorize players to set session time limits. When evaluating a casino, take the time to check out the footer of the website—often the licence and security entropy is posted there. If it is missing or vague, that is a red flagstone. In summary, the first step in any casino review is to verify that the operator holds a valid licence from a recognised Canadian or provincial potency, uses robust encryption, and submits to regular independent audits. Without these fundamentals, no amount of attractive bonuses or title variety can make up for the increased danger to your cash in hand and personal data. Always prioritize licensing and security above all other factors when building trust with an online casino. Additionally, players should be aware of the distinction between provinces: while Ontario has its have regulated iGaming market since April 2022, other provinces like British Columbia (via BCLC) and Quebec (via Loto-Québec) operate their have online platforms or partner with licensed operators. Some offshore casinos also keep licences from the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which are recognised internationally but may not offer the same consumer protections as Canadian provincial regulators. It is advisable to corroborate that the casino accepts Canadian dollars and offers customer support in English or French. Also, check for a privacy policy that explains how personal data is collected, stored, and shared—a reputable casino will never sell your entropy without consent. Finally, appear for evidence of responsible gambling certifications such as GamCare or Gambling Therapy logos, which indicate the operator is committed to punter welfare. By good examining these licensing and security aspects, Canadian players can significantly decrease the risk of encountering a fraudulent or unethical casino.

Assessing Payout Speed and Player Reputation

After confirming that a casino is right licensed and secure, the next crucial factor for Canadian players is the reliability and speed of payouts. A casino that is financially sound and respects its customers will process withdrawals promptly and without unnecessary complications. Typical payout times for reputable casinos are within 24 to 48 hours for e-wallets such as PayPal, Skrill, or ecoPayz, and between three to five business days for bank transfers or credit card withdrawals. In Canada, Interac e-Transfer is a widely used method, and premier casinos often process these requests within 24 hours. However, it is not simply the speed that matters—transparency in the withdrawal policy is equally important. Look for clear information about minimum and maximum withdrawal amounts, any processing fees, and the identity verification process (Know Your Customer or KYC). Casinos that delay payouts without conclude, impose hidden fees, or require excessive documentation are not to be trusted. Player reputation is a powerful indicator of a casino’s trustworthiness. Spend time meter reading reviews on independent platforms such as CasinoMeister, AskGamblers, or ThePOGG. Pay attention to how the casino responds to complaints: a responsible operator will actively resolve issues and pass with players. A chronicle of unresolved complaints, especially regarding withdrawals, is a major warning signalize. Additionally, consider the age of the casino—well-established operators with years of consistent serving are in general more reliable than recent, unproven sites. For lesson, brands like Jackpot City and Spin Palace have been operating for over two decades and have built a reputation for rapid payouts and fair dealings. Newer casinos, while often offering attractive bonuses, may not have the financial stability or track record to honour large withdrawals. Another important aspect is the variety of withdrawal methods available. Canadian players should look for casinos that support Interac e-Transfer directly, as well as Instadebit, iDebit, and bank wires. Some casinos also offer cryptocurrency withdrawals via Bitcoin or Ethereum, which can be processed within minutes. However, be cautious of casinos that only offer obscure or high-fee withdrawal methods. Also, pay attention to any wagering requirements tied to bonuses that may affect withdrawal eligibility—bonuses often interlock funds until playthrough conditions are met. Always read the terms and conditions carefully before claiming a bonus.
